Searched refs:PendingAssessment (Results 1 – 2 of 2) sorted by relevance
74 class PendingAssessment final : public Assessment {76 explicit PendingAssessment(Zone* zone, const InstructionBlock* origin, in PendingAssessment() function83 PendingAssessment(const PendingAssessment&) = delete;84 PendingAssessment& operator=(const PendingAssessment&) = delete;86 static const PendingAssessment* cast(const Assessment* assessment) { in cast()88 return static_cast<const PendingAssessment*>(assessment); in cast()91 static PendingAssessment* cast(Assessment* assessment) { in cast()93 return static_cast<PendingAssessment*>(assessment); in cast()284 PendingAssessment* const assessment,
420 operand, zone()->New<PendingAssessment>(zone(), block, operand))); in CreateForBlock()437 PendingAssessment* const assessment, int virtual_register) { in ValidatePendingAssessment()445 ZoneQueue<std::pair<const PendingAssessment*, int>> worklist(&local_zone); in ValidatePendingAssessment()452 const PendingAssessment* current_assessment = work.first; in ValidatePendingAssessment()507 const PendingAssessment* next = PendingAssessment::cast(contribution); in ValidatePendingAssessment()541 PendingAssessment* pending = PendingAssessment::cast(assessment); in ValidateUse()621 PendingAssessment::cast(found_op->second), in VerifyGapMoves()